Free-Motion Monogramming

Monogramming adds a personal and professional touch to garments, home
decorating items and craft projects. When monogramming, the feed dogs are
covered, allowing for free-motion sewing.

Materials:
Embroidery hoop
8" x 8" cotton with an iron-on interfacing
Fabric marking pen
Procedure:
Using the fabric marking pen, draw the desired monogram letter.
Place fabric in the embroidery hoop, making sure the fabric is taut.
Place the hoop under the foot, positioning the needle over the starting
point of the monogram.
Lower the presser foot.
